Bhujang Asana -- Lie flat on your stomach, keeping the palms out, bend the neck backward, take a deep breath and while holding it for 6 seconds, raise the chest up. Release breath and relax your body. Repeat the exercise 15 times twice daily. Core Strengthening Exercises- Straight Leg Raised With Toes Turned Outward, repeat 10 times, twice a day.

Always take care of your spine and never avoid your problem. It is a progressive disease. All you need to do is exercises for your entire spine 1. Lie flat on your back and place two regular rounded towels exactly under your curved spine where there is kyphosis. Do regular breathing cycles for 5-10 minutes. This is a correction for kyphosis. 2. Lie on your stomach with pillow under the hip (must). Raise left arm 10 times and right arm 10 times. Continue the same exercise for both the legs. 3. If you are a swimmer then start swimming as an exercise for 30 minutes. Water properties have proven the best for treating AS. Feel free to ask further questions.
